Ahmad Sheikh

Hardware Modeling

Ahmad Sheikh possesses extensive experience in hardware modeling and verification, currently working at Luminous Computing since July 2021, where responsibilities include C++ cycle-accurate reference modeling and instruction set simulator development for machine learning VLIW accelerators, as well as SystemC modeling for RISC-V CPUs. Prior to this, Ahmad served as a Modeling and Verification Engineer at Apple from January 2019 to June 2021, focusing on C++ reference models of ASIC IP and firmware development. Ahmad's career commenced at Qualcomm, spanning over a decade from July 2007 to January 2019, where the focus was on WLAN PHY systems, including fixed-point bit-true reference models and digital design. Ahmad holds a Master of Science in Electrical and Computer Engineering from The University of Texas at Austin and a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ering from the University of Engineering and Technology, Lahore.
